High Court Judge refused entry to NZ
One of the Fiji High Court Judges, Judge Justice Anjala Wati from the Family Court has been refused entry into New Zealand.

In a press conference held in the last hour, Attorney General Aiyaz Sayed Khaiyum revealed that Judge Wati had applied for a NZ medical visa in order to take her 20 month old child for an urgent eye operation to prevent loss of sight in one of her eyes.

However, she was advised that her visa application had been rejected as she had taken up a position as a judge in the High Court of Fiji.

Attorney General Aiyaz Sayed Khaiyum has labeled the move by the NZ Government as unacceptable by any world standard.

Sayed Khaiyum will now be taking the matter up to the Prime Minister.
